| give notice 
 
 1. inform (somebody) of something
 - I advised him that the rent was due

 2. terminate the employment of;
 discharge from an office or position
 - The boss fired his secretary today
 - The company terminated 25% of its workers
 • Syn:
 displace, fire, can, dismiss, give the axe,
 send away, sack, force out, give the sack, terminate
 • Ant:
 hire (for: fire)
